Technical Field
The utility model belongs to the technical field of the automobile pedal, specifically speaking relates to a novel anti-skidding car side footboard.
Background
The automobile pedal is arranged at the position of the automobile threshold, and can play a role in protecting the automobile body and facilitating passengers to get on and off the automobile. However, the automobile pedal in the prior art is generally formed by combining a panel, a pedal base and a bracket, is single in shape, and is fixed on the side face of an automobile in a suspension manner through the bracket, and the pedal body is designed in a direct plane. At the moment, the inner side of the pedal body is suspended, a larger gap exists between the pedal body and the automobile body, the pedal is very abrupt in assembly, the attractiveness is poor, the gap is large, the noise generated in the running process of the automobile is high, the stability is poor, muddy water is splashed to the inner side of the support, and the sealing protection performance is poor. In addition, the surface of the pedal is generally provided with regular anti-skid protrusions, namely anti-skid lines in the same direction, and the modeling specification is single.
Therefore, a novel automobile side pedal with strong skid resistance, skirt protection on the inner side of the pedal, obtrusiveness, attractive appearance improvement and assembly toughness enhancement is urgently needed at present.

Detailed Description
The following detailed description will be provided with reference to the accompanying drawings and examples, so that how to implement the technical means of the present invention to solve the technical problems and achieve the technical effects can be fully understood and implemented.
Referring to fig. 1 to 4 together, fig. 1 is a side view of a novel anti-skid automobile side pedal according to an embodiment of the present invention; fig. 2 is a top view of the novel anti-skid automobile side pedal according to the embodiment of the invention; FIG. 3 is a schematic view of a pedal panel according to an embodiment of the present invention; fig. 4 is a bottom view of the novel anti-skid automobile side pedal of the embodiment of the present invention.
As shown in the figure, a novel anti-skidding automobile side pedal comprises: the pedal comprises a main pedal framework 10, wherein a heightening platform 11 is arranged on the inner side of the main pedal framework 10, and an inner surrounding skirt 12 extending upwards is arranged on the inner side of the heightening platform 11; the pedal panel 20 is fixed on the upper side of the main pedal framework 10 and is positioned outside the heightening platform 11, and the pedal panel 20 is provided with a plurality of positioning clamping feet 21 inserted into the heightening platform 11 from the side; the tubular beam bracket 30 is welded at the lower side of the main pedal framework 10; a plurality of installation bases 40, installation base 40 one end welds in tubular beam support 30 downside, and the other end extends and is fixed to the frame.
In an embodiment of the present invention, the main pedal frame 10 is integrally made of a material with high strength, and has a plurality of reinforcing ribs and a strip shape. The outer side of the upper surface of the main pedal framework 10 is covered with a fixed pedal panel 20 for treading, the inner side is formed into a heightening platform 11 to form a partition, and an inner surrounding skirt 12 extends upwards to play the roles of smooth transition of the inner side and strengthening protection, and meanwhile, the gap between the pedal and the frame is filled, so that the attractiveness is improved, and the assembly toughness is strengthened.
The pedal panel 20 can be fixed on the upper surface of the main pedal framework 10 by means of buckling or bonding or welding, the side surface of the pedal panel is provided with a plurality of extending positioning clamping feet 21, and the positioning clamping feet 21 are inserted into the side surface of the heightening platform 11 to form a buckle, so that the stability after assembly is enhanced. Preferably, the side of the heightening platform 11 is provided with a clamping hole for clamping the positioning clamping pin 21, the end of the positioning clamping pin 21 is T-shaped and is reversely buckled, and the clamping stability is good.
The tubular beam support 30 is welded and fixed on the lower side of the main pedal framework 10, and preferably can be arranged into two ways of end-to-end connection, so that the contact area is increased, and the bearing strength is improved. The installation base 40 is welded on the lower side of the tubular beam support 30, and a plurality of groups are arranged according to requirements and assembled to the frame, so that the reinforcing effect is stable. Preferably, 4 sets of mounting feet 40 are provided at intervals. The installation base 40 multistage is buckled, and increase strength, and the tip sets up the bolt hole, fixes to the frame through construction bolt, and it is convenient to install.
In addition, the pedal panel 20 is provided with a first anti-skid surrounding ring 51 and a second anti-skid surrounding ring 52 which are separated from each other in the front-back direction, the first anti-skid surrounding ring 51 and the second anti-skid surrounding ring 52 are attached to the inner edge and the outer edge of the pedal panel 20 and occupy enough space positions, a plurality of convex anti-skid units 60 are arranged inside the first anti-skid surrounding ring 51 and the second anti-skid surrounding ring 52, the anti-skid effect is enhanced, the safety of pedaling is guaranteed, and a logo long groove platform 70 is reserved on the first anti-skid surrounding ring and used for printing a logo to form decoration.
In a preferred embodiment, the anti-slip unit 60 is composed of a plurality of parallel anti-slip linear edges, and the anti-slip linear edges are protruded to enhance friction and ensure pedal safety.
Further, the anti-slip units 60 in the first anti-slip enclosure 51 and the second anti-slip enclosure 52 are arranged into a plurality of groups, and the anti-slip lines of the anti-slip units 60 in each group have different orientations and different lengths, that is, the anti-slip units 60 with different specifications can be presented in the first anti-slip enclosure 51 and the second anti-slip enclosure 52, the anti-slip units 60 are composed of parallel anti-slip lines, and the anti-slip units 60 in each group have different specifications and different orientations and lengths, so that the friction force can be improved to the maximum extent, and the pedal anti-slip performance with sufficient safety is ensured.
